Reviving the Rails: Examining America’s Passenger Train Future: A Comprehensive Study on the Decline and Future of America’s Railways

Rate this book
In the late 19th century, a journey across America by train was not just a means of travel but a symbol of progress. Trains were more than just mechanical marvels; they embodied hope and opportunity, a technological leap forward that promised endless possibilities. Yet, just as the whistle of the train signaled hope, the mid-20th century ushered in a somber reality. The rapid transformation from the heyday of rail to its subsequent decline invites us to ask some tough questions. How did we transition so swiftly away from a mode of transport that once captured America's imagination? And perhaps more importantly, why should we care today?

Globally, other countries have embraced rail travel as a solution to many of the issues facing the United States today. High-speed trains zoom across Europe and Asia, linking cities in record time while minimizing environmental impact. These success stories offer lessons that could be invaluable in reshaping the future of American railroads. If nations like Japan and France can make high-speed rail work efficiently, why can't the United States? Exploring these international examples can provide fresh insights into what is possible and inspire a vision for an interconnected, sustainable future.

This book will not only illuminate the intricate tapestry of American rail history but also inspire reimagining its potential in a rapidly evolving transportation landscape. Each chapter delves into different facets of rail travel, from its historical roots to modern innovations and potential futures, offering a comprehensive look at where we've been and where we might go.
